Lazy Loading of Dynamic Dependencies The default model for loading a dynamic dependency is to load it into memory and examine it for any additional dependencies. Technical Notes This error does not necessarily occur when you first bring up an application. ld.so.1: bpcompatd: fatal: relocation error: file /usr/openv/lib/libVbp.so: symbol kms_errmsgstr: referenced symbol not found Killed NetBackup compatibility daemon started. Under this default model, all dependencies of an application are loaded into memory, and all data relocations are performed, regardless of whether the code in these dependencies will actually be referenced http://supercgis.com/relocation-error/relocation-error-referenced-symbol-not-found.html
Another use of preloading is to augment a function that resides in a standard shared object. Any dependency found following the option takes on the loading attribute specified by the option. Documentation Home > Solaris Common Messages and Troubleshooting Guide > Chapter 2 Alphabetical Message Listing > "L" > ld.so.1: string: fatal: relocation error: string: string: referenced symbol not foundSolaris Common NetBackup Event Manager started. https://docs.oracle.com/cd/E19455-01/806-1075/msgs-1552/index.html
This is the error you originally reported. Have you sourced one of the environment setup scripts (or200env, or2006env.csh) before? 2012-06-25 #3 (permalink) aemme Ingres Community Join Date: Jul 2009 Posts: 605 Some week ago I However, this seems to be strictly a perl-embed issue. Java: Fatal: Relocation Error: Because this is a fatal error, the application terminates with this message.
So, I would recommend to check: - LD_LIBRARY_PATH - the output of the command "ldd -d $II_SYSTEM/ingres/bin/w4gldev" to get a list of referenced libraries - check if they are there and Symbol Sema_timedwait: Referenced Symbol Not Found ld.so.1: nbstserv: fatal: relocation error: file /usr/openv/lib/libVbpMT.so: symbol kms_errmsgstr: referenced symbol not found Killed NetBackup Storage Service Manager started. If so, why is it allowed? page For example: grep /var/sadm/install/contents libX11.so.4 Then find the path to libX11.so.4 and add it to LD_LIBRARY_PATH When this is compleated you can then run the ldd again and verify that all
Because immediate references must be resolved when an object is initialized, any dependency that satisfies this reference must be immediately loaded. Symbol Unsetenv: Referenced Symbol Not Found All Rights Reserved LinkBack LinkBack URL About LinkBacks MenuExperts Exchange Browse BackBrowse Topics Open Questions Open Projects Solutions Members Articles Videos Courses Contribute Products BackProducts Gigs Live Courses Vendor Services Groups Why did the Ministry of Magic choose an ax for carrying out a death sentence? Are there any ways to speed up blender compositor?
CAUSE: This is due to NetBackup being incorrectly installed, corrupt or version mismatched installation of NetBackup. http://supercgis.com/relocation-error/relocation-error-undefined-symbol.html Remove advertisements Sponsored Links RTM View Public Profile Find all posts by RTM « Previous Thread | Next Thread » Thread Tools Show Printable Version Email this Page Subscribe to this file /usr/local/apache2 /modules/mod_cwmp_22.so: symbol curl_easy_init: referenced symbol not found Now, here we go. Forum Operations by The UNIX and Linux Forums www.sun.com docs.sun.com | 3.Runtime Linker Relocation Processing When Relocations Are Performed Relocation Errors The most common relocation error occurs when Ld.so.1: Oracle: Fatal: Relocation Error
while trying to execute an application, i encountered thefollowing error: ld.so.1: myApplication : fatal: relocation error: file /opt/oracle/oradb/lib/libHotDB50.so: symbol sqlcxt: referenced symbol not found my questions : 1) what is relocation Thus the old functionality can be completely hidden with the new preloaded version. Thus, the initialization sections of those sections are executed in their reverse load order. http://supercgis.com/relocation-error/referenced-symbol-not-found-relocation-error.html Try adding this to LD_LIBRARY_PATH as Jimsil suggested.
I have to wait for the system administrator to install such lib. Ld.so.1 Httpd Fatal Relocation Error Action Run the ldd -d command on the application to show its shared object dependencies and symbols that are not found. Close Sign In Print Article Products Article Languages Subscribe to this Article Manage your Subscriptions Problem ld.so.1: nbemm: fatal: relocation error: file /usr/openv/lib/libVbpMT.so: symbol kms_errmsgstr: referenced symbol not found Solution
If you see => and nothing to the right then the library on the left caan not be found and you may need to change the LD_LIBRARY_PATH variable to include the If you preload an object containing this function, the object will interpose on the original. Alternatively, you could look (very carefully) at the crle command. 0 LVL 1 Overall: Level 1 Unix OS 1 Message Expert Comment by:Jimsil2004-07-28 As jon stated you are either missing Error Relocating : Symbol Not Found By indicating that this library can be lazily loaded, the expense of processing can be moved to those invocations that ask for debugging output.
It could take months to develop, if ordinary use of the application seldom references the undefined symbol. Why were Native American code talkers used during WW2? Pre-initialization functions are not permitted in shared objects. his comment is here I really do not know what and where this "sqlcxt" is.
CALL US: 1 (866) 837-4827 Solutions Unstructured Data Growth Multi-Vendor Hybrid Cloud Healthcare Government Products Backup and Recovery Business Continuity Storage Management Information Governance Products A-Z Services Education Services Business Critical Join & Ask a Question Need Help in Real-Time? You can use these mechanisms to experiment with a new implementation of a function that resides in a standard shared object. Solved fatal relocation error referenced symbol not found killed Posted on 2004-07-26 Unix OS 1 Verified Solution 6 Comments 5,623 Views Last Modified: 2013-12-27 hi experts today i installed GPS 1.4.0
Because of the default mode of lazy binding, if a symbol used as a lazy reference cannot be found, the error condition will occur after the application has gained control. RESOLUTION: Reinstalling NetBackup will resolve this issue. Connect with top rated Experts 19 Experts available now in Live! The library /opt/gps/lib/libgdk-x11-2.0.so.0 does not contain the function XkbLibraryVersion.
Previous: ld.so.1: string: fatal: string: open failed: No such file or directoryNext: ld.so.1: string: fatal: relocation error: symbol not found: string © 2010, Oracle Corporation and/or its affiliates Documentation Home > Veritas does not guarantee the accuracy regarding the completeness of the translation. maybe do a strings -a on libcurl on both dev and prod, make sure they match up. Search the page for relocation - Sun docs - relocation error As far as your 3rd question, Nikk answered that well in check your LD_LIBRARY_PATH.